The Life of Mammals - S01E03 - Plant Predators (4th December 2002) [DVDRip (XviD)]seeders: 1
leechers: 0
The Life of Mammals - S01E03 - Plant Predators (4th December 2002) [DVDRip (XviD)] (Size: 700.26 MB)
Description
Category: TV Shows
Subcategory: UK Size: 700.26 megabyte Ratio: 2 seeds, 0 leechers Language: Unknown Uploaded by: hannibal_TheBox Sharing Widget |